Comparison of the Diagnostic Sensitivity of Nasopharyngeal and Nasal Swabs and Use of Viral Loads for the Molecular Diagnosis of Equine Herpesvirus-1 Infection

The nasopharyngeal swabbing technique for the molecular detection of equine herpesvirus-1 (EHV-1) is not well tolerated in horses; nasal swabbing represents a viable alternative. Nasal swabs seem to be diagnostically more sensitive than nasopharyngeal swabs for the detection of low EHV-1 loads in naturally exposed horses. With regard to EHV-1 viral-load signatures in blood and nasal secretions, differences between clinically affected and subclinically affected horses and between those in the febrile and neurological stages of the disease are present on nasal swabs. The finding of high viral loads in the nasal secretions of neurological horses confirms their importance as a potential source of contagion for other horses and highlights the need for imposition of strict biosecurity measures when faced with horses with suspected or confirmed neurological EHV-1 infection. Our results also support the need for development of a consensus on the use and interpretation of molecular diagnostic techniques in the evaluation of field cases of suspected EHV-1 infection.
